Summary:

The C & K Radio Manufacturing Company 299 7th Street, Brooklyn, New York offered a line of "kit" radios in the early 1920's. In a December 1922 Radio News magazine advertisement fully assembled but unwired models were offered. This was one way to get around the lack of an Armstrong Regenerative patent, offer an assembled kit that the user could wire as a regenerative receiver.
